About this role
The Structural Engineer at Atwell will focus on the design and analysis of structural steel and concrete foundations for utility-scale solar, battery energy storage systems (BESS), and substation projects. This role involves collaborating with multi-disciplinary teams, leading engineering efforts from project initiation to completion, and ensuring compliance with industry standards and safety codes. The engineer will also draft technical documents and may assist in proposal development and cost estimation.

What you need
- Bachelor’s Degree in Structural or Civil Engineering (ABET Accredited)
- Professional Engineer (PE) or Structural Engineer (SE) License required
- Strong understanding of structural engineering principles
- Proficiency in using MS Office, Outlook, Teams, AutoCAD, and Bluebeam
- Ability to develop custom design tools using Mathcad or Excel
- Proficiency in structural design software such as ROBOT, RISA 3D, RISA Foundation, L-PILE, MFAD and Hilti PROFIS Engineering Suite
Nice to have
- Experience with software such as Revit, PVcase, Civil 3D, and transmission line modelling tools (PLS-CADD, PLS-POLE, or PLS-TOWER)
